Pet Monkeys for Sale UK: Legality, Breeders & Costs

Considering getting a monkey in the UK? Regrettably, the situation regarding buying monkeys in the UK is challenging. By law, it's highly restricted to own them. Nearly all monkeys are categorized as protected species under the Act and require a special license from officials. Discovering reputable breeders is in addition difficult, as many exist in a unregulated space. Costs are high, ranging from £5,000 to £20,000+ at first, and that's before regular expenses like expert food, enclosures, and animal care.

Pet Monkeys for Sale in PA: Ethical & Legal Problems

While the thought of owning a little monkey may seem attractive , the fact of obtaining them in Pennsylvania, and elsewhere, raises significant ethical and regulatory questions. Sadly , despite occasional listings appearing online, selling primates as companions is heavily regulated, and often outright restricted, due to their complex needs and the potential for damage . Many states, including Pennsylvania, have laws concerning exotic animal ownership. These rules typically involve stringent permitting processes, requiring specialized enclosures and detailed knowledge of primate care. In addition, the comfort of these intelligent, social animals is a major point. They require specific diets, pet monkey for sale near tampa fl healthcare attention, and enrichment to prevent unhappiness , often beyond the resources of a typical family .

Ultimately , advocating for responsible species conservation means allowing monkeys in their natural ecosystems, rather than treating them as commodities for sale.
